Farrah Fawcett established the FFF 2007 shortly after her own cancer diagnosis. Since 2015, Tex-Mex Fiesta has raised close to $1 million to date, with proceeds benefitting Stand Up To Cancer(SU2C), supporting cutting-edge research. Stand Up to Cancer (SU2C) partnered with FFF in valiant hopes to find a cure.

“When she was alive, we didn’t have amino therapy, didn’t have molecular based therapy Farrah was so upset that there were no novel therapies and she started this foundation. We’ve been able to partner with Stand Up to Cancer and now we have vaccine trials.” – Doctor Lawrence Poir, Event Co-Chair and FFF Chief Medical Advisor.
